Narrative:
THE PLT WAS ON AN AEROBATIC DEMONSTRATION flight. AS HE WAS COMPLETING AN OVER-THE-TOP MANEUVER, THE ACFT HIT THE GROUND AT HIGH SPEED, THEN TUMBLED INTO A LAKE BEFORE COMING TO REST. WITNESSES RPRTD THAT THE PLT HAD BEEN CONSISTENTLY TERMINATING HIS MANEUVERS AT A VERY LOW ALTITUDE THROUGHOUT THE DEMONSTRATION. CAUSE: PILOT'S FAILURE TO COMPLETE THE AEROBATIC MANEUVER IN A MANNER WHICH INSURED ADEQUATE TERRAIN CLEARANCE AT THE TERMINATION.
